David Barter Biography and Net Worth

David joined Cellebrite as CFO in July 2025, bringing more than three decades of public company financial leadership experience. Prior to joining Cellebrite, he served as CFO at New Relic where he played an instrumental role in supporting the company’s growth to nearly $1 billion in annual revenue, transitioning the company to a consumption-based model, improving profitability and cash flow and supporting a successful $6.5 billion sale of the business in late 2023. Barter previously served as CFO at c3.ai and model N as well as held senior finance positions at Guidewire Software, Microsoft and General Electric. He holds an M.B.A. and a Master of Engineering Management from Northwestern University’s Kellogg School of Management, and a B.B.A. in Finance and Philosophy from the University of Notre Dame.

Cellebrite DI Company Overview

Cellebrite DI logo
Cellebrite DI Ltd. develops solutions for legally sanctioned investigations in Europe, the Middle East, Africa, the Americas, and the Asia-Pacific. The company's DI suite of solutions allows users to collect, review, analyze, and manage digital data across the investigative lifecycle with respect to legally sanctioned investigations used in various cases, including child exploitation, homicide, anti-terror, border control, sexual crimes, human trafficking, corporate security, cryptocurrency, and intellectual property theft. It provides Inseyets, a digital forensics software that collects and reviews digital evidence from various digital sources when conducting legally sanctioned investigations. The company's digital forensics software also offers data extraction, decoding capabilities, workflows, and automation capabilities. In addition, it provides Cellebrite Pathfinder, which reduces the time spent manually reviewing digital evidence by automating data analysis and visualization; Smart Search, an open source intelligence tool that automates the collection and review of publicly available online data; and Guardian, a case and evidence management solution. Further, the company offers digital forensic software for enterprises and service providers, including Inseyets for Enterprise, Endpoint Inspector, and Mobile Now; and professional services, such as training and certification services, and other services. It serves federal and state and local agencies. The company was incorporated in 1999 and is headquartered in Petah Tikva, Israel.
